What Is a Visa Gift Card? (And Why Nigerians Trade Them)

A Visa gift card is a preloaded debit-style card that can be used anywhere Visa cards are accepted. These cards are issued in the US, UK, Canada, and other regions. Although extremely convenient overseas, many Nigerian users struggle with redeeming them directly on local platforms.

Can You Cash Out a Visa Gift Card Directly in Nigeria?

Not directly.
Most Nigerian banks do not support loading Visa gift card balances into local accounts.

Types of Visa Gift Cards Nigerians Commonly Trade

Visa gift cards come in different forms, and the type affects the payout rate:

1. Physical Visa Gift Cards

These are plastic cards, usually with a scratch-off PIN.

2. E-code Visa Gift Cards

Digital codes delivered through email—popular for online purchases.

3. Prepaid Visa Cards

Often reloadable; treated like gift cards in Nigerian exchanges.

4. Regional Variations

Rates may differ based on:

  • US Visa card
  • UK Visa card
  • Canadian Visa card
  • EU Visa card

In 2025, US Visa cards typically have the highest demand.

Why You Should Never Sell Visa Gift Cards to Random Buyers

Many people lose money through WhatsApp buyers, Telegram traders, or social media “agents.”

Common scams include:

❌ Fake proof of payment
❌ Partial payment scams
❌ Claiming the card is “empty”
❌ Blocking you after redeeming
❌ Card detail harvesting
❌ Payment delays for days or weeks

To stay safe in 2025, avoid trading outside secure platforms.
